Ingredients

  1. 1 cup almond milk (dairy substitute)
  2. 1 cup gluten-free flour blend (gluten substitute)
  3. 1/4 cup coconut oil (butter substitute)
  4. 1/2 cup applesauce (egg substitute)

Instructions

  1. Gather all ingredients and ensure they are at room temperature for optimal mixing consistency.
  2. In a medium mixing bowl, sift the gluten-free flour blend to remove any potential clumps and ensure smooth incorporation.
  3. Melt the coconut oil gently in a small saucepan over low heat or in the microwave, allowing it to become liquid but not hot.
  4. Combine the almond milk, melted coconut oil, and applesauce in the mixing bowl with the gluten-free flour blend.
  5. Whisk the ingredients together thoroughly until a smooth, uniform mixture is achieved with no visible dry flour spots.
  6. Let the mixture rest for 2-3 minutes to allow the gluten-free flour to fully absorb the liquid ingredients.
  7. Depending on your specific recipe needs, this base mixture can now be used for baking, cooking, or as a foundational ingredient substitute.
  8. Store any unused mixture in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
